Well to be perfectly honest pal, there isn't one stand which has all 3. :blush: The South easily has the best facilities and has great food on offer, but isn't normally very full and has a pretty poor atmosphere. It's probably got the best view though.The North has good views and is the best value for money stand i think in terms of view for price, but has very average facilities. It's got a decent atmosphere though.The Kop has the best atmosphere and is cheapest, but has (IMO) the poorest facilities of all 3 stands and the worst view.I'd probably recommend the South if you're trying to show us to be a good club as they will be able to see a full(ish) North from their seat, and enjoy a great view of the pitch and good refreshments.
